In fact, what Sun Chengzong said was the first major event that plagued Liao affairs in the late Ming Dynasty - the discord between the superintendents and the appeasement (through the discord).

"Du" refers to "Jiliao Governor", "Fu" refers to "Liaodong Governor", and "Jing" refers to "Jiliao Jinglu".

In terms of the Liaodong battlefield, the rights and responsibilities of the two positions of Jiliao Supervisor and Jiliao Jingluo are the same, and the difference is only that the honor of Jiliao Supervisor is higher.

The first person to get the position of Jiliao Inspector was Sun Chengzong, and the setting of the "Supervisor" was mainly because Sun Chengzong was the emperor. But since Sun Chengzong, those who serve as the superintendent of Jiliao do not have to be the emperor's master, and this name has been extended to be a kind of honor and the emperor's weight.

After Sun Chengzong, Wang Zhichen and Yuan Chonghuan were also appointed as the superintendent of Jiliao. In addition, such as Xiong Tingbi, Wang Zaijin, and Gao Di, they all served as Jiliao Jingluo.

Jiliao Jingluo and Jiliao Governor are nominally under the jurisdiction of Ji, Liao, Deng, and Jin (in fact, Jizhen is under the jurisdiction of the Jiliao Governor), and they are both suspended from the military department, and they are basically awarded the sword of Shang Fang (except for Wang Zaijin), who is mainly responsible for fighting against Houjin, so there is no essential difference in power and responsibility.

The discord between the governor and the governor refers to the disagreement between the Jiliao Governor (or the Jiliao Jingluo) and the Liaodong Governor.

The Jiliao Governor (or Jiliao Jingluo) had direct jurisdiction over the Liaodong Governor. However, in practice, since the governor of Liaodong is the direct person in charge of Liaodong Town, many of the orders of the Jiliao Governor (or Jiliao Jingluo) need to be implemented by the Liaodong Governor, and the Liaodong Governor also has the power to directly relieve the imperial court.

Therefore, the governor of Liaodong can either question the order of the Jiliao Governor (or Jiliao Jinglu) before executing it, or directly obtain the support of the imperial court to oppose the order of the Jiliao Governor (or Jiliao Jingluo), which leads to the Liaodong Governor having a certain ability to compete with the Jiliao Governor (or Jiliao Jingluo).

Liaodong defense is like a daughter-in-law, but there are two mothers-in-law, the Jiliao Governor (or Jiliao Jingluo) and the Liaodong Governor, so there are naturally many problems. In fact, starting from Xiong Tingbi, no one from the previous governors could escape this strange circle.

The first person to make a fuss was Xiong Tingbi. In the first year of the Apocalypse, Liao Shen was defeated, and Xiong Tingbi took office as Ji Liao, only to meet Wang Huazhen, the governor of Guangning (later changed to the governor of Liaodong).

Wang Huazhen, the governor of Guangning, and the governor of Liaodong after him actually had the same powers. Wang Huazhen can actually be regarded as a courageous talent. After the defeat of the Ming Dynasty in Liaoshen, the people were panicked, Wang Huazhen was Ning Qiandao at the time, stepped forward, gathered the dispersed, inspired the people, contacted the western Mongolia, and asked the edict to Korea, praise loyalty, and reluctantly share the same hatred.

It is for this reason that Wang Huazhen was appreciated by the imperial court and appointed as the governor of Guangning, so that he was in charge of the first line of defense of Mingjin. In addition, Wang Huazhen was also a student of Shoufu Ye Xianggao at that time, and he was indeed meritorious, so he had the capital to compete with his boss Ji Liao Jingluo Xiong Tingbi.

Xiong Tingbi was the main defender, and Ji Lu planned to use three lines of defense with nearly 300,000 troops to block Houjin's offensive; Wang Huazhen attacked the main one, proposing that Liaodong could be recovered with only 60,000 troops.

The result of the first discord was that the governor Wang Huazhen had the upper hand, and the Quang Ninh front was basically controlled by Wang Huazhen. Soon, the soldiers of the Later Jin Dynasty let the Ming Dynasty taste the bitter fruit of this self-defeating. In the first month of the second year of the Apocalypse, Nurhachi launched the Battle of Guangning, and the unprepared Wang Huazhen was defeated, and the 120,000 Ming army outside the pass collapsed, while the two defense lines of Shanhaiguan and Jindeng originally designed by Xiong Tingbi did not provide any support to the front line at all.

One of the reasons is that Wang Huazhen was defeated too quickly, and the other is that the discord between the two countries outside the customs and inside the customs has led to their own affairs. In the face of Wang Huazhen's retreat, Xiong Tingbi, who was obsessed with discord, made the only mistake in his life - and the big mistake that killed him.

Abandoning Guangning, and even abandoning all the land outside the Guan, is the reason for Xiong Tingbi's death, he did not play a positive role in the defeat, but because of schadenfreude and neglected the overall situation, his crime also deserved to die.

After the defeat of Guangning, Xiong Wang and Wang were dismissed from their posts and questioned for their crimes, and it was Wang Zaijin who succeeded Xiong Tingbi, but the post of governor was temporarily vacant, and was later replaced by Yan Mingtai.

Wang did not have a governor when he was promoted to Jiliao Jingluo, so there should have been no problem of discord and discord. But there was a bold junior official who took over the tradition of the governor and defying the scriptures. This person is Yuan Chonghuan, who was the commander of Ning Qiandao at the time.

The contradiction between Wang Zaijin and Yuan Chonghuan was where the Ming army's defensive line was to be arrangedβ€”Wang insisted on retreating to Shanhaiguan, while Yuan Chonghuan demanded the restoration of the land to Ningyuan. Neither of the two of them could convince anyone, so Yuan Chonghuan directly sued Shoufu Ye Xianggao about the problem.

However, Ye Xianggao, who was far away in the capital, didn't know the situation on the front line of Ludao, so he couldn't make up his mind. At this time, Sun Chengzong, a scholar, stepped into the front desk of Liao Affairs, "Please go to the decision". Sun Chengzong went to the front line of Liaodong, inspected the actual geography, listened to the opinions of all parties, and finally refuted Wang Zaijin's plan to retreat to Shanhaiguan and adopted Yuan Chonghuan's proposal to defend Ningyuan.

"Chengzong's face is not enough in Jin, but it is changed to the secretary of the Nanjing Military Department...... In Jin, Chengzong invited himself to supervise the teacher. ”

After Sun Chengzong took office as the governor of Jiliao, the tradition of supervising discord continued. The first governor recommended by Sun Chengzong for appointment was Yan Mingtai. As a result, Yan Mingtai was incompetent, and Zhang Fengyi took over.

Unexpectedly, after Zhang Fengyi succeeded as governor, he was worse than Yan Mingtai. When Sun Chengzong was discussing the plan to defend Liao, Yan Mingtai's proposal was to go out of Juehua Island before. It can be said that in the Liaodong defense line finally decided by Sun Chengzong, Yan Mingtai's suggestions were also included. However, Zhang Fengyi returned to Wang Zaijin's old path, "Fengyi is cowardly, and he will return to the master to guard the customs." ”

Since Nurhachi's "Seven Hatreds" sacrificed to the heavens, the Ming army has been defeated repeatedly, and officials and generals have actually generally had "gold-phobia". Zhang Fengyi's proposal was immediately approved by many officials and generals, but it aroused Sun Chengzong's displeasure.

After the construction of Ningyuan was completed, Sun Chengzong asked the imperial court to move the governor of Liaodong to Ningyuan, but Zhang Fengyi thought that Sun Chengzong wanted to put himself to death, so he and his fellow villagers Yunyi and Youfu destroyed the world dragon in order to shake Sun Chengzong.

"Shilong" is Ma Shilong, the chief soldier of the mountains and seas appointed by Sun Chengzong, and the result of Zhang Fengyi's small action was that Sun Chengzong immediately asked him to get out of the way after discovering it, and took Yu An Xingyu as Liaofu.

Yu Anxing and Ma Shilong have a discord, but after all, there is no major contradiction with Sun Chengzong. The discord between the governors during Sun Chengzong's first Liao period ended in the complete victory of Sun Chengzong's two governors.

In September of the fifth year of the Apocalypse, Ma Shilong credulously believed the informant and suffered a defeat at Liuhe, which led to the removal of Sun Chengzong and Yu Anxing one after another.

Gao Di took over as Jiliao Jingluo, and the post of governor of Liaodong was vacant again. Yuan Chonghuan, the commander of Ningqian Dao's military preparation, once again crossed the rank to inherit the practice of economic discord, and the new boss Gao Di was on top of the bull.

Due to the defeat of Liuhe, Gao Yiyi asked to give up all land outside the Guanwai when he took office, but Yuan Chonghuan refused. As the commander of Ningqian Dao, Yuan Chonghuan couldn't control the affairs of Jinzhou, so he stuck to Ningyuan and refused to retreat, "I Ningqian Dao, the official should die here, I will not go."

In the first month of the following year, Nurhachi invaded the Ming Dynasty on a large scale, attacking Ningxia far from being down, and the Ming army won the first defensive victory on the frontal battlefield, and Yuan Chonghuan became famous. After the war, Gao Di was dismissed for his crimes, Wang Zhichen took over as the governor of Jiliao, and Yuan Chonghuan was promoted to the governor of Liaodong.
